San Juan
- A first class municipality
- Increasing population driven by its thriving tourism insdustry
- The most visited LGU in Batangas in 2020
- Tourism is driven by its proximity and accessibility from Metro Manila (2-3 hours travel time)
- San Juan is surrounded by Marine Protected Areas. It is part of the Verde Island Passage - a strait that is extremely rich in marine biodiversity.
- Popular beach destination
- Vast Mangrove forests
- Mountains for hiking
- Heritage houses and historical church
- Adventure park
- Food and local products
